In Elgin, you should seek legal counsel from a criminal lawyer the moment you are arrested, charged with a crime, or even if you believe you are under investigation. Early intervention is critical because initial interactions with law enforcement and any statements made can significantly impact your case. A defense attorney can advise you on your rights and begin constructing your defense strategy immediately, potentially preventing charges from being filed or securing a more favorable outcome.

Elgin lawyers typically handle a wide array of criminal cases, including DUI offenses, drug-related charges, assault and battery, theft, and domestic violence. They also represent clients facing more serious allegations such as burglary, robbery, and other felonies. The specific charges dictate the defense strategy, which might involve challenging evidence, negotiating plea agreements, or preparing for trial. Their objective is to safeguard the client's rights and achieve the best possible result.
Preparing for a trial in Elgin involves a comprehensive strategy. The defense attorney will meticulously review all evidence presented by the prosecution, conduct independent investigations, and interview potential witnesses. They will file essential pre-trial motions, such as motions to suppress illegally obtained evidence or dismiss charges. Crafting a persuasive narrative and preparing witnesses for testimony are also vital components. The goal is to effectively challenge the prosecution's case and present a strong defense.
If you are questioned by law enforcement in Elgin, it is crucial to politely assert your right to remain silent and your right to an attorney. Do not answer any questions about the alleged incident without legal counsel present, as anything you say can be used against you. Contacting a criminal defense attorney immediately is the best course of action to ensure your constitutional rights are protected during any interaction.
A DUI conviction in Illinois carries significant consequences, including substantial fines, mandatory attendance at alcohol education or treatment programs, and driver's license suspension or revocation. Jail time is also a possibility, especially for repeat offenses or if the DUI involved property damage or injuries. A conviction can also lead to increased insurance rates and difficulties in obtaining certain employment opportunities.
Yes, a criminal lawyer in Elgin can assist with expunging or sealing a criminal record in Illinois. The process has specific eligibility requirements based on the offense and the time elapsed since the conviction. An attorney will assess your qualifications, manage the necessary legal documentation, and navigate the court procedures to petition for the removal or sealing of your record, which can greatly benefit future opportunities.
